  1. which climate zones would a race participant go through if they traveled along the tropic of capricorn from west to east through australia? (select all that apply)

a. marine west coast
b. arid
c. semiarid
d. humid subtropical

Identify the geographic path

The question asks for the climate zones crossed when traveling west to east along the Tropic of Capricorn (approximately \(23.5^\circ\text{ S}\)) through Australia.

Analyze climate zones along the path

Using Oceania Climate Zones knowledge:

  • Starting on the west coast of Australia (near Coral Bay/Exmouth), the climate begins as semiarid before quickly transitioning into the vast arid interior (the Great Sandy, Gibson, and Simpson Deserts).
  • Traveling eastward, the route transitions back through a semiarid belt in Queensland.
  • Reaching the east coast of Australia (near Rockhampton), the climate is humid subtropical.
  • The marine west coast climate is located in southeastern Australia (Tasmania and parts of Victoria) and is not crossed by the Tropic of Capricorn.

Determine correct options

The climate zones crossed are therefore arid, semiarid, and humid subtropical.
